在如今的互联网时代,网站的顺利开发与运营对于企业的发展至关重要。其中,数据库作为网站的基石,其连接问题更是关系到整个网站的正常运行。本文将针对做网站时数据库连接方面遇到的问题进行详细解答。
问题概述
在网站开发过程中,数据库连接问题常常让开发者们头疼不已。这些问题可能包括连接失败、连接超时、数据传输错误等。这些问题不仅会影响网站的访问速度,还可能导致网站崩溃,给用户带来极差的体验。解决数据库连接问题,对于保障网站的稳定运行至关重要。
问题分析
数据库连接问题的产生原因可能有很多,以下是一些常见的问题及原因分析:

1. 数据库配置错误:包括数据库地址、端口、用户名、密码等配置不正确,导致无法连接到数据库。
2. 网络问题:网络不稳定或存在防火墙等安全设置,阻碍了数据库连接的建立。
3. 数据库服务未启动:数据库服务未正常启动,导致无法响应连接请求。
4. 数据库权限问题:用户权限不足,无法访问特定数据库或表。
5. 数据库性能问题:数据库负载过高,导致连接超时或响应缓慢。
解决方法
针对以上问题,我们可以采取以下措施进行解决:
1. 检查数据库配置:确保数据库地址、端口、用户名、密码等配置正确无误。
2. 检查网络连接:确保网络稳定,无防火墙等安全设置阻碍连接。
3. 检查数据库服务状态:确保数据库服务已正常启动并运行。
4. 检查用户权限:确保用户具有足够的权限访问特定数据库或表。
5. 优化数据库性能:对数据库进行优化,降低负载,提高响应速度。
具体实施步骤
1. 查看错误日志:查看网站或数据库的错误日志,了解具体的错误信息。
2. 分析问题原因:根据错误信息,分析问题的具体原因。
3. 修改配置或代码:根据问题分析结果,修改数据库配置或相关代码。
4. 测试连接:在修改后,进行数据库连接测试,确保问题已解决。
5. 监控与维护:定期对网站和数据库进行监控与维护,及时发现并解决问题。
网站开发中的数据库连接问题是一个常见且重要的问题。通过了解问题的产生原因及采取相应的解决方法,我们可以有效地解决这些问题,保障网站的稳定运行。在具体实施过程中,我们需要仔细分析问题原因,采取合适的措施进行解决,并进行定期的监控与维护,以预防类似问题的再次发生。我们也需要不断学习和掌握新的技术与方法,以应对日益复杂的网站开发环境。